We have been able to determine that this is working as it was before the upgrade with one minor exception that has been resolved.
Whenever someone uses the code tags (http://forums.emc.com/forums/help.jspa#code) the text between the tags is not subject to word breaking at 80 characters. Though this makes the "code" more readable, it can have the unfortunate side effect of making the page really wide.
When you switched to the flat view the wide page problem appeared to have disappeared; however, it didn't. Because in the flat view the replies are paged, the problem was masked, but if you navigate to page 3 you will notice that the page width is once again wide.
The minor exception that has been resolved is before the upgrade the code segments were formatted to make it more noticable that they were different. This formatting did not get turned back on after the upgrade. We have now turned this back on.
